About This Topic

Oil sits at the intersection of economics, environmental science, geopolitics, and business strategy, making it one of the most widely studied topics across undergraduate and graduate curricula. Courses in international relations, energy policy, supply chain management, environmental studies, and corporate strategy all find reason to assign work on oil because the industry touches nearly every dimension of modern life. Its role as a commodity that shapes national development, drives company operations, and fuels geopolitical competition gives it sustained academic relevance that extends well beyond any single discipline.

The papers archived on this topic reflect a broad range of analytical approaches. Some focus on specific industry cases, examining offshore drilling operations, Arctic exploration, or BP's activity in the Gulf of Mexico to ground arguments in concrete business and environmental terms. Others take a policy angle, exploring how legislation such as Nigeria's local content law affects capacity building and industry development within a country. Macroeconomic analysis also appears frequently, particularly in papers that assess how oil markets influence the US economy or shape stock market behavior in major producing nations like Saudi Arabia. Comparative and regional approaches round out the collection, with work situating oil within Latin American development and broader natural resource frameworks.

A strong essay on oil needs a focused thesis that commits to one dimension — economic, environmental, geopolitical, or corporate — rather than attempting to cover all at once. Evidence drawn from documented industry operations, policy texts, and financial reports tends to carry the most weight. The most common pitfall is treating oil as a backdrop rather than the direct subject of analysis, which produces papers that are descriptive rather than argumentative.
